Hi everyone. We began the internet service in our computer shop, but I want to know how does LAN games allows only in LAN and blocks from accessing internet. Games such as Warcraft III, Counter Strike, GTA IV and others have LAN and internet support, and we want to keep them on LAN so that clients (particularly brainless kids) don't go online and autoupdate games. I tried to browse in Firewall advance option, but there are too many options to block them (I was confused). I need some help here. Thanks

If you don't want the computer to have access to the internet at all, one way to achieve this is to remove the gateway address from the LAN adapter config. Depending on which version of Windows you have, you can also lock down this setting with group policy editor
